工作中,使用ansible等自动化运维工具实现服务器批量自动化运维管理,需要先解决管理端和被管理端的免密码登录,可以脚本实现ssh基于key的验证,代码如下: 将需要部署的机器IP写入hosts.txt文件中,每行一个 ...
分类:
其他好文 时间:
2019-12-11 22:00:08
阅读次数:
159
Linux初窥:Linux下SSH免密码登录配置 根据上述文章进行配置完成。 需求:两台机器A、B,实现从A机器上免密登录至机器B 思路是: 1、A机器上使用ssh-keygen -t rsa 生成秘钥(无密码)。生成在指定路径下的id_rsa.pub文件。 2、将A机器上的id_rsa.pub中最 ...
分类:
系统相关 时间:
2019-12-07 23:29:02
阅读次数:
117
先说一下 Xshell如何无密连接虚拟机: 最主要的是你的虚拟机要和主机屏通! ssh登录提供两种认证方式:口令(密码)认证方式和密钥认证方式。其中口令(密码)认证方式是我们最常用的一种,这里介绍密钥认证方式登录到linux的方法。使用密钥登录分为3步:1、生成密钥(公钥与私钥);2、放置公钥(Pu ...
分类:
系统相关 时间:
2019-11-20 21:31:04
阅读次数:
117
集群中配置多台机器之间 SSH 免密码登录 问题描述 由于现在项目大多数由传统的单台机器部署,慢慢转变成多机器的集群化部署。 但是,这就涉及到机器间的 SSH 免密码互通问题。 当集群机器比较多的时候,如何能快速简洁地配置机器之间的免密码登录呢? 完美方案 1、分别查看集群的机器上,是否安装了 SS ...
分类:
其他好文 时间:
2019-11-07 09:15:48
阅读次数:
120
目录 目录 1 1. 前言 3 2. 缩略语 3 3. 安装步骤 4 4. 下载安装包 4 5. 机器规划 4 6. 设置批量操作参数 5 7. 环境准备 5 7.1. 修改最大可打开文件数 5 7.2. 修改OOM相关参数 6 7.3. 免密码登录设置 6 7.4. 修改主机名 6 7.4.1. ...
分类:
其他好文 时间:
2019-11-02 19:52:11
阅读次数:
98
前述:这篇文档是建立在三台虚拟机相互ping通,防火墙关闭,hosts文件修改,SSH 免密码登录,主机名修改等的基础上开始的。 一.传入文件 1.创建安装目录 mkdir /usr/local/soft 2.打开xftp,找到对应目录,将所需安装包传入进去 查看安装包:cd /usr/local/ ...
分类:
其他好文 时间:
2019-11-02 18:07:15
阅读次数:
78
原文地址:https://blog.csdn.net/longgeaisisi/article/details/78680180 ssh登录提供两种认证方式:口令(密码)认证方式和密钥认证方式。其中口令(密码)认证方式是我们最常用的一种,这里介绍密钥认证方式登录到linux的方法。使用密钥登录分为3 ...
分类:
系统相关 时间:
2019-10-29 11:39:33
阅读次数:
273
首先先说明一下有密码的,涉及到root登陆权限的问题: 1、用超级管理员身份登录,修改 vi /etc/ssh/sshd_config, 找到 把其中的permitRootLogin 修改成: # Authentication: LoginGraceTime 120 PermitRootLogin ...
分类:
系统相关 时间:
2019-10-26 21:03:00
阅读次数:
311
正常的登录mysql的过程一般是执行如下命令: mysql -uroot -p 然后输入密码。在本地的linux系统中如果是希望把数据自动存储于数据库,非常的不方便。 找到对应的目录,创建.my.cnf文件 如果是root用户,就在/root目录下,执行 vim .my.cnf 如果是其它用户,就在 ...
分类:
数据库 时间:
2019-10-05 20:30:21
阅读次数:
218
scp传输文件和文件夹 #向远端传文件 $ scp [-r] dir/file_name user_name@ip_addr/domain_name:dir #从远端往本地传文件 $ scp [-r] user_name@ip_addr/domain_name:dir/file_name dir u ...
分类:
其他好文 时间:
2019-09-25 12:49:48
阅读次数:
113